#ArtSpeaks is a day of community and conversation with a program of gallery talks. Staff members choose artworks of special meaning for them, and speak about the ways that art makes a difference in the world. Talks are seven minutes in length and take place every 30 minutes from 11:00 a.m. to 4:00 p.m. Learn more: mo.ma/artspeaks
